Market on Main
Farmers market in Evansville, Indiana
Visiting Market on Main
- Address
- Ford Center Plaza 6th and Main St, Evansville, IN 47715
- Hours
- Wednesday 9:30am–1:30pm
Markets are seasonal — always confirm before a long drive.
- Season
- June to September
- Vendors
- 30 reported by the market
- Finding it
- Located on Main St in Downtown Evansville between MLK and 6th St on the Ford Center Plaza
- Set-up
- Closed-off public street
- Website
- marketonmainevv.com

Paying at this market
SNAP / EBT is accepted. The market accepts EBT at a central location
Nutrition programs
- WIC Farmers Market
- WIC
- Senior Farmers Market Nutrition Program
- SNAP
- Accept EBT at a central location
Payment accepted
- Debit card/Credit card
Payment and benefit details come from the market's own USDA listing and can change season to season.
How the food here is grown
Growing practices reported by vendors at Market on Main:
- Organic (USDA Certified)
"Organic (USDA Certified)" means at least one vendor holds certification — it does not certify the market itself.
What's sold at Market on Main
Product categories the market reported to the USDA across its 30 vendors. Individual stalls vary week to week with what is in season.
- Fresh fruits
- Fresh vegetables
- Baked goods
- Canned or preserved fruits/vegetables
- Coffee/tea
- Crafts/woodworking items
- Cut flowers
- Dairy products.
- Eggs
- Honey
- Pet food
- Poultry/fowl meat and products
- Prepared foods
- Red/other non-poultry meat and products
- Soap/body care products
